Family friendly hiking trails around Eschenburg traverse a diverse landscape of rolling hills, dense forests, and scenic valleys in Germany's Lahn-Dill-Kreis. Situated in the foothills of the Rothaargebirge and bordering the Gladenbacher Bergland, the municipality is largely wooded, providing extensive natural environments. Hikers can explore varied terrain, from gentle slopes to higher elevations like the Eschenburg mountain (589 meters) and Angelburg (600 meters). The region is characterized by its mixed forests and offers numerous viewpoints with impressive panoramas.

What kind of terrain can we expect on family hikes in Eschenburg?

You can expect varied terrain, from gentle, rolling hills to dense mixed forests and scenic valleys carved by rivers. Many paths are well-trodden forest trails, offering a natural and engaging experience. Some routes, like the 'Eschenburger Panoramaweg,' are known for their breathtaking views over the surrounding landscape.

Are there trails with good panoramic views?

Yes, Eschenburg is renowned for its impressive panoramic views. Trails often lead to viewpoints offering vistas of the Siegerland, and into the Ebersbach, Rossbach, and Dietzhölz valleys. The Tiefenrother Höhe viewpoint is particularly noted for its fantastic vistas, and the 'Eschenburger Panoramaweg' is named for its scenic outlooks.

What natural landmarks or points of interest can we see on family hikes?

A significant natural landmark is the Wilhelmsteine rock formation near Hirzenhain, which is a popular point of interest for hikers. You can explore routes like the Wilhelmsteine Rock Formation – View of the quarry near Hirzenhain loop to experience it firsthand. The region also features beautiful valleys such as the Irrscheldetal Valley and the Sohler Bach Valley.

Are there any castles or historical sites near the family-friendly trails?

Yes, the Eschenburg area is rich in history. You can find several castles and historical sites nearby. Notable attractions include Hainchen Moated Castle, Wittgenstein Castle, and the impressive Wilhelmsturm and the Dillenburg Casemates. The Dillenburg Old Town and Castle also offers a fascinating glimpse into the past.
